We had a client that worked in a location with old utilities. In most cities, there are some old areas that don’t have a good underground infrastructure. There are old phone lines with no cable or fiber connections. The internet service is really bad and slow there. It frequently goes out and businesses can only get around 3 to 5GB internet speed. This was the case for our client. Their internet was very unstable and would go down from time to time causing major disruption to workflow. We were able to locate a point-to-point Internet Provider and add a secondary circuit, which increased their internet speed and resiliency. When the firewall noticed one circuit was not working, it routed traffic to the other. Problem solved. Work stoppages ended, workflow increased, and productivity maximized.
